Summary: | In this paper we presented an algorithm for image quality measurement based on HVS properties and singular value decomposition. Both of the original and the distorted image are first pre-processed according to HVS properties and then their image matrixes are transformed into vectors by singular value decomposition. By comparing the angle between singular vectors of the original image and the distorted one, the quality of an image can be measured. The algorithm can be sensible to the perceptual error and can be implemented easily. We validated the performance of this algorithm using an extensive study involving many types of images, and the experiment result shows that it has good correlation with the subjective score. |
